Latvia vs Taiwan
Latvia is 78% larger than Taiwan. Taiwan would fit into Latvia about 1.8 times.

Why the map you grew up with disagrees
On a Mercator map, area grows with distance from the equator. Latvia sits at about 57°N and is stretched to 3.35× its true area; Taiwan at 24° N is stretched to 1.19×. That difference is why Latvia looks so much bigger than it is next to Taiwan. The figure above uses the Equal Earth projection, where every square kilometre is drawn the same size.
